Job Description
Total Safety is looking for a Buyer to add to their safety conscious team! The Buyer provides timely and cost-effective procurement of goods and services to support the company’s distribution plans in the designated regions and commodity categories. They are responsible for maintaining inventory levels through the procurement process of necessary goods in a timely, economical, and efficient manner in order to meet company goals. The hourly pay scale for this job is $22-25.


About Total Safety


Total Safety is the world's premier provider of integrated safety and compliance services and the products necessary to support them, including gas detection, respiratory protection, safety training, fire protection, compliance and inspection, industrial hygiene, onsite emergency medical treatment/paramedics, communications systems, engineered systems design, and materials management. Our Core Values are People, Safety & Wellbeing, Accountability, Responsibility, Empowerment, Honesty, Transparency, and Integrity.


Position Responsibilities


  • Work with the Company’s Sales team to ensure any changes to product offerings are reflected in the annual plan and/or periodic re-forecasts.
  • Identify potential cost savings ideas and process improvements, saving time and money.
  • Control inventory levels and return excess inventory as needed to bring inventory levels to optimum levels, reducing the risk of overstock and obsolesce.
  • Work with Warehouse and Account Payable to resolve issues related to invoice payments and material receipts.
  • Build and maintain vendor relationships
  • Evaluate inventory liability for items that are pending discontinuation or at risk of expiration.
  • Follow up with suppliers on order confirmation and to track on-time delivery.
  • Review ERP demands and place purchase orders for multiple branches.
  • Other duties as required.
  • Evaluate and determine the best total costs to justify the decision to purchase or transfer inventory to meet customer demands.
  • Negotiates price, quality, delivery and terms with selects supplier and places purchase orders while assuring compliance to local and Corporate Operating Procedures and Ethical Code of Conduct.
  • Develop and maintain target inventory levels for items based on near- and long-term forecasts, based on analysis and collaboration with other key departments.
